Description
Haplogroup C2b1a (C-M401) is the core Mongolic branch of C2b1 and the direct ancestor of the 'Star Cluster' (C2b1a1-F3918) associated with Genghis Khan and the Borjigin dynasty. C2b1a is strongly concentrated in Mongolia, among Buryats, and in the Mongolian-speaking populations of China (Inner Mongolia). It splits into two subclades: C2b1a1, the famous Star Cluster lineage that expanded explosively in the 13th century CE, and C2b1a2 (Z22424), a sister clade found among Mongolian populations that did not participate in the same founder effect. The MRCA of C2b1a lived approximately 4,000 BCE — several thousand years before Genghis Khan — indicating a deep prehistorical origin for Mongolic paternal lineages on the Mongolian plateau.
Interesting Fact
The extraordinary diversity within C2b1a reveals that the Mongolian plateau was home to a significant C2b1a-carrying population for thousands of years before Genghis Khan — the 13th-century explosion of C2b1a1 (Star Cluster) was not the origin of Mongolic lineages, but the final and most extreme episode in a long history of C2b1a dominance on the steppe.
